2012-10-23 31 views
5

हम सेलेनियम परीक्षण (फ़ायरफ़ॉक्स स्वचालन) चला रहे हैं और मैं इसे हेडलेस मणि का उपयोग करके पृष्ठभूमि में अग्रेषित करना चाहता हूं। (Https://github.com/leonid-shevtsov/headless)।मैक ओएसएक्स मौटन शेर में फ़ायरफ़ॉक्स एक्स 11 10.8

सबकुछ शेर पर अच्छी तरह से काम कर रहा था लेकिन मॉउटन शेर में एक्स 11 को हटाने के बाद, मुझे फ़ायरफ़ॉक्स एक्स 11 संस्करण काम नहीं मिल रहा है। मैंने XQuartz को सफलता के बिना कोशिश की है।

क्या आप मैक ओएसएक्स मौटन शेर 10.8 में फ़ायरफ़ॉक्स एक्स 11 स्थापित करने का कोई तरीका जानते हैं? धन्यवाद!

का उपयोग करना:

  • फ़ायरफ़ॉक्स 16
  • Watir Webdriver
  • XQuartz 2.7.4
  • मैक्स OSX (बाध्यकारी सेलेनियम माणिक) 10.8.2
+0

'sudo बंदरगाह स्थापित फ़ायरफ़ॉक्स-x11' करने के लिए कोशिश कर रहा है: ---> ---> फ़ायरफ़ॉक्स-X11 के लिए पैच लागू करने का विन्यास फ़ायरफ़ॉक्स-X11 ---> बिल्डिंग फ़ायरफ़ॉक्स-X11 त्रुटि: ऑर्ग पोर्ट फ़ायरफ़ॉक्स-x11 के लिए .macports.build लौटा: कमांड निष्पादन विफल रहा बग की रिपोर्ट करने के लिए, मार्गदर्शिका में दिए गए निर्देशों का पालन करें: http://guide.macports.org/#project.tickets त्रुटि: पोर्ट फ़ायरफ़ॉक्स की प्रसंस्करण- x11 असफल ' – Hartator

उत्तर

-2

मैं करना पसंद नहीं होता अब xvfb का उपयोग करें। यदि आप हेडलेस जाना चाहते हैं तो अपने ड्राइवर के रूप में phantomjs का उपयोग करने का प्रयास करें।

+0

फ़ैंटोमज बहुत सारे संसाधनों का उपयोग करता है –